About Emporia Energy Emporia is a leading technology company revolutionizing home energy by providing affordable, integrated solutions that empower homeowners to optimize energy usage to reduce costs and carbon footprint. Emporia’s Home Energy Management Platform is a powerful software system that connects their Vue Home Energy Monitor, Level 2 EV Charger, Smart Plugs, Home Battery, and third-party thermostats and appliances. By automating energy use through real-time monitoring and scheduling, the platform optimizes consumption, reduces costs, and simplifies home energy management—all within one intuitive app. With over 400,000 U.S. homes running Emporia’s energy management and EV charging hardware, we are now launching a national Third-Party Owned (TPO) home battery Virtual Power Plant — placing industrial-rated home batteries in residential homes to deliver power redundancy, utility cost savings, and grid peak demand services. Role Overview Emporia's TPO battery program is running simultaneously across multiple states with permitting, utility interconnection, VPP enrollment, and regulatory compliance all moving at once. The Manager overseeing this needs a right hand: someone who can own the administrative and coordination backbone of the program so nothing slips between AHJ calls, utility follow-ups, tracker updates, and status reporting. This is a coordinator-level role built to grow. You'll start by taking ownership of the trackers, registers, and follow-up cadences that keep the program honest, then expand into owning discrete workstreams (a state, a vendor relationship, a compliance thread) as you build fluency. Think of it as an apprenticeship into program management for a fast-moving, multi-state regulated energy business.
